Output 84e02f84064bbec546b3eb89f401c01c2f29e0651a1d3c1a26cb2ca9929f3f59:36

value
4990979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39f5e8febfc5a9dee6953b5b8189466e821f4f21 OP_EQUALVERIFY OP_CHECKSIG
address
16HU755AfDrnWQF8jYzKCYc7KcB6p3rG1K
transaction
84e02f84064bbec546b3eb89f401c01c2f29e0651a1d3c1a26cb2ca9929f3f59
spent
true